What is a Crypto Games Casino?
A crypto video games casino is an online betting platform that supports the deposit, withdrawal, and wagering of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and Tether (GBPT). Unlike standard online gambling establishments that function mostly through fiat currencies (GBP, EUR, GBP), crypto casinos utilize the cryptographic security of the blockchain to help with transactions.
Numerous of these platforms likewise integrate "Provably Fair" innovation-- a cryptographic approach that permits players to independently confirm the randomness and fairness of each game outcome. This shifts the paradigm from "trusting the casino" to "confirming the mathematics," providing a level of openness previously hidden in the gaming industry.

Critical Considerations: Safety and Security
While the benefits are substantial, the digital nature of cryptocurrency needs a heightened level of personal duty. Users must adopt the following best practices:
- Use Reputable Platforms: Only select gambling establishments with a solid history, transparent ownership, and favorable neighborhood feedback on forums like Bitcointalk or Reddit.
- Validate Licensing: Check if the casino is accredited in jurisdictions such as Curacao or other recognized video gaming authorities.
- Enable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Always secure your casino account with 2FA to prevent unapproved access.
- Use Hardware Wallets: Never save big quantities of your crypto on the casino website. When you have significant profits, withdraw them to a personal hardware wallet.
- Understand Volatility: Remember that the worth of your cryptocurrency can vary. A win in Bitcoin might be worth considerably more or less in fiat terms by the time you choose to cash out.

What is "Provably Fair" technology?
It is a system that utilizes cryptographic hashing to generate random outcomes. Gamers can take the "seed" numbers offered by the game, run them through an open-source confirmation tool, and verify the casino did not manipulate the outcome.
Can I lose my crypto if the casino goes offline?
Yes. If a casino is unregulated or deceptive, it can shut down without caution. This is why selecting established, credible platforms is vital.
